So I've been thinking recently of exporting a "rendered" animation from google sketchup, and I need to know the potential when it comes to 2 points:
-
Is there a certain plugin/software/rendering engine that can handle rendering animations?
-
What kind of animations does it support? Camera movements or in model animations?? Because I need to create waterflow animation "similar to particles works in 3DsM" and I have no clue whether it could be done or not?

You have Twilight who support the Plugins animation Mover, properanimation and Sketchyphysic
And you have a crazzy one plugin Simfonia(who don't support the "Scene animation") but you can make your own "scenes animations", even "Deformation" animation!!!
